Product Description

Product Description

Whether you are the owner of your own small business, a middle manager in a mid-sized company, or the CEO of a multinational, this book aims to show you how to improve your profits and productivity, following the principles of the Deming management method. Dr. W. Edwards Deming, a statistician and management consultant, proposes a thorough reformation of the way managers manage. Change, Dr Deming believes, starts at the top with an informed, quality-conscious management. The book includes advice on how to achieve that level of management expertise in the author's analysis of Dr Deming's 14 points for managers and his deadly diseases of mangagement.

Deming got it right 6 Feb 2011
Format:Paperback
Deming was a real management GURU of the type we need more of in the world of business. He gave us all not only a management guideline with ideas from the East for the West to apply but he gave us a guideline for a way of life which we often fail to apply in the West We are suffering from 'deadly sins'.

It is well worth reading Mary Walton's book as the Deming ideas are given a simple airing that everyone will find ease to read and acknowledge.

OK 5 Jun 2010
Format:Paperback
I didn't really like this book. There was something completely insubstantial about her tales of the activities of the big man. I got the feeling she didn't know much about management but was just writing about what she felt to be important. I recommend you skip this and buy The New Economics by the man himself.
